- 1
apply for a visacollocation/əˈplaɪ fɔːr ə ˈviːzə/
to submit an application to get permission (a visa) to enter a country
“You should apply for a visa well before your trip if required.”
- 2
tourist attractioncollocation/ˈtʊərɪst əˈtrækʃən/
a place that people visit because it is interesting or famous
“The museum is the main tourist attraction in the town.”
- 3
lost luggagecollocation/lɒst ˈlʌɡɪdʒ/
baggage that has been misplaced or has not arrived with you
“We waited at the desk to report our lost luggage.”
- 4
stay at a hotelverb phrase/steɪ æt ə həʊˈtɛl/
to spend time staying in a hotel while travelling
“We usually stay at a hotel near the train station when we travel.”
- 5
check in atcollocation/tʃek ɪn æt/
to register your arrival at a hotel or at the airport before a flight
“We need to check in at the hotel before 10 pm.”
- 6
go sightseeingverb phrase/ɡəʊ ˈsaɪtˌsiːɪŋ/
to visit interesting or famous places while travelling
“We spent the afternoon going sightseeing around the old town.”
- 7
check out ofcollocation/tʃek aʊt ɒv/
to complete the official process of leaving a hotel
“We need to check out of the hotel by noon.”
- 8
stay overnightcollocation/steɪ ˌəʊvəˈnaɪt/
to remain somewhere for the night
“We decided to stay overnight in the town to avoid a late drive.”
- 9
book a flightcollocation/bʊk ə ˈflaɪt/
to buy a plane ticket for a specific journey
“I need to book a flight to Hanoi next month.”
- 10
travel insurancecollocation/ˈtrævəl ɪnˈʃʊərəns/
an insurance policy that covers problems during a trip, like medical costs or lost luggage
“Before my trip I always buy travel insurance in case of emergencies.”
- 11
travel abroadcollocation/ˈtrævəl əˈbrɔːd/
to go to another country for tourism, work, or study
“Many students hope to travel abroad for their studies.”
- 12
travel documentscollocation/ˈtrævəl ˈdɒkjʊmənts/
papers needed for travel, such as passport, visas, and boarding passes
“Make sure you keep all important travel documents in a safe place.”
- 13
go on holidaycollocation/ɡəʊ ɒn ˈhɒlɪdeɪ/
to spend time away from home for rest or recreation
“We're planning to go on holiday in August.”
- 14
public transportcollocation/ˈpʌblɪk ˈtrænspɔːt/
transportation available for the general public, such as buses, trains, and subways
“Using public transport in big cities is often cheaper than taxis.”
- 15
book a hotelcollocation/bʊk ə həʊˈtel/
to reserve a room at a hotel for a future date
“We need to book a hotel for our weekend trip before prices go up.”
- 16
currency exchangecollocation/ˈkʌrənsi ɪksˈtʃeɪndʒ/
the process or place where one currency is exchanged for another
“I went to a currency exchange at the airport to get local cash.”
- 17
take a tripcollocation/teɪk ə ˈtrɪp/
to go on a short journey somewhere
“Let's take a trip to the coast this weekend.”
- 18
pack your bagscollocation/pæk jɔː ˈbæɡz/
to put clothes and belongings into suitcases or bags for a trip
“Don't forget to pack your bags the night before the flight.”
- 19
peak seasoncollocation/piːk ˈsiːzən/
the period of highest demand for travel, when prices and crowds are usually greatest
“If you travel in peak season, you should book well in advance.”
- 20
miss a flightcollocation/mɪs ə ˈflaɪt/
to fail to get on the plane for which you have a ticket
“We missed our flight because of the traffic.”
